To the latest substantial activity when you look at the rates of interest, of numerous consumers, and individuals with FHA finance, remain thinking in case it is a very good time in order to re-finance its financial. Refinancing can be a great option, based on your circumstances. For the majority borrowers, a good re-finance you will reduce steadily the payment per month, take away the mortgage insurance requisite (if you do at the very least 20% security home), or allow you to cash out guarantee to many other expenditures.
But refinancing boasts threats, and it is never the best option each debtor. If you aren’t saving sufficient on the mortgage repayment, you might lose cash due to closing costs or perhaps be needed in order to meet highest standards compared to the new of them expected to secure the https://paydayloancolorado.net/haswell/ fresh new FHA mortgage. To determine if or not refinancing is the better selection for your, its worthy of spending some time carefully given any selection, that could ensure you select the most readily useful highway send.

- FHA Easy Refinancing: An enthusiastic FHA Simple Refinance ‘s the trusted of all the possibilities. It is an easy method which enables people to lessen its interest levels from the switching to an adjustable-speed financial or a fixed-rates loan. Some great benefits of a simple re-finance try that you could all the way down the rate and remove co-individuals throughout the FHA financing (sometimes, co-individuals must contain the FHA financing initially). At exactly the same time, you could potentially finance the fresh new settlement costs, and therefore reduces your importance of up-front financial support. Sadly, this one cannot assist someone seeking to utilize its home equity since there is no bucks-out element, and borrowers need to pay to own a current house assessment. At the same time, the credit requirements to help you secure this re-finance be a little more strict than FHA funds, therefore consumers should have a credit history of at least 580 to acquire so it loan.
- FHA Streamline Refinance: An FHA Streamline re-finance is similar to a straightforward refinance but has no need for an assessment or even in-depth credit report, and thus it can be approved a lot faster than simply a straightforward re-finance. A smooth re-finance is only a selection for consumers who have not started over a month late over the past six months otherwise had more than one percentage more thirty day period later during the last a year. Additionally, the brand new debtor have to have generated at the very least half a dozen payments in this at least 210 months since the amazing mortgage is actually secured. For people who high quality, this 1 allows new debtor to re-finance for more than brand new house is really worth, although settlement costs must be reduced upfront, cash-out choices are restricted to $five-hundred in the domestic equity, and borrowers must pay home loan insurance premiums.
- FHA Dollars-Out Re-finance: This makes you transfer your home equity so you’re able to cash by allowing new citizen re-finance the existing mortgage into the a new financial getting an elevated share. Following, they have the improvement overall lump sum. Being qualified for it particular refinance need a credit rating of at the very least 580 and a debt-to-money proportion out of 43% otherwise reduced. The borrowed funds-to-worth proportion never surpass 80% of one’s house’s really worth, definition individuals must continue no less than 20% collateral. This one is great for borrowers who wish to utilize the property value the security. Although not, they ount and/or monthly payments. Additionally needs home loan insurance policies and property assessment.
- FHA 203(k) Refinance: The very last style of refinance alternative, a keen FHA 203(k) loan, is great for people wanting to include do it yourself or restoration costs to their home loan. Within classification, there are 2 selection a restricted 203(k), that allows individuals to obtain around $thirty five,000 to have renovations, or a fundamental 203(k), with no limit but makes it necessary that the fresh citizen invest on minimum $5,000 with your own money into the family repairs. The main benefit of this would be the fact it does continually be covered with a lower life expectancy rate of interest than many other brand of domestic improve money, and has now less restrictive credit history criteria. not, the fresh new approval techniques takes longer that is limited to number one home use.
